You will need to put insulation. A piece of 35mm film seems to do the trick I would be tempted to put some insulation on the metal part of the shoe to avoid any possible problems with shorting the info pins.
Even if you use the 5P connector on the side of the AF540, any shorts on the flash's hotshoe will scupper the communication between camera and flash.
I hacked an old Pentax 4P grip - drilled and filed out the 5th hole (so it wouldn't touch) and also drilled out the little locking hole in the grip (the AF540 has a small pin that descends when you tighten the locking nut).
EDIT: If you use wireless flash from the pop-up on the camera, then there doesn't appear to be any issues with shorting on the hotshoe AFAIK. It's only when the flash is tethered to the camera that things can go awry.

The rule is that you can use older Pentax flashes on newer bodies, but not vice-versa (without modification).
As Matt says, a bit of old film makes a good insulator. Who said film was dead?
